In a strategic working visit underscoring deep bilateral ties, Abdellatif Hammouchi, Director General of Morocco’s National Security and Territorial Surveillance (DGSN-DGST), received Ali Obaid Al Dhaheri, head of the United Arab Emirates’ national intelligence agency, at the DGSN headquarters in Rabat.
According to an official statement from Morocco’s national security authority, the meeting marked a significant milestone in enhancing bilateral intelligence cooperation and expanding joint security initiatives between the two nations.


Key Areas of Discussion:
- Strengthening operational coordination in counterterrorism, including the exchange of sensitive intelligence;
- Assessing terrorist threats in Africa, particularly across the Sahel and Sahara regions;
- Addressing regional security tensions and their potential implications for Arab and international stability.
Both parties reaffirmed their commitment to a strategic partnership aimed at neutralizing terrorist threats and bolstering regional and global peace and security.
